Quantitative Aptitude

Number System and Digits

374 Questions

Number system and digits questions test the ability to manipulate numbers, identify significant digits, and form specific values. These problems often require finding missing digits or determining the properties of large sums. They form a vital component of the quantitative aptitude section.

Standard Visa card numbers always contain 16 digits. This is part of the ISO/IEC 7812 standard for payment cards. MasterCard also uses 16 digits, while American Express uses 15 digits.
